Who is Izumi Matsumoto?

Kazuya Terashima, pen name Izumi Matsumoto, is a Japanese manga artist best known for Kimagure Orange Road. His career started in 1982, publishing his comic Milk Report in the manga magazine Weekly Shonen Jump. But real success came in 1984, publishing in the same magazine his masterpiece Kimagure Orange Road. Other works: Sesame Street, Black Moon.

He has revealed that he is afflicted with a cerebrospinal fluid disease that has forced him to take six years off work, and he now hopes to bring attention to this disorder through his manga.
